

Sultamicillin 375 mg is a potent oral antibiotic that combines ampicillin and sulbactam to effectively combat a wide range of bacterial infections. This combination enhances the antibiotic spectrum, making it effective against beta-lactamase-producing bacteria that are resistant to ampicillin alone. Sultamicillin is commonly prescribed for respiratory tract infections, urinary tract infections, skin and soft tissue infections, and gynecological infections.
Sultamicillin 375 mg is a broad-spectrum oral antibiotic used to treat various bacterial infections effectively. It is a mutual prodrug of ampicillin and sulbactam, formulated in a 2:1 ratio to overcome resistance from beta-lactamase-producing bacteria. This makes it highly effective against infections that do not respond to ampicillin alone.

One of the major challenges in modern healthcare is antibiotic resistance. Many bacteria produce beta-lactamase enzymes that make standard antibiotics ineffective. Sulbactam in Sultamicillin neutralizes these enzymes, allowing Ampicillin to destroy bacteria effectively.

The typical adult dosage is 375 mg taken orally twice daily for 5 to 14 days, depending on the severity and type of infection. In the treatment of uncomplicated gonorrhea, a single oral dose of 2.25 g (six 375 mg tablets) may be administered.

India’s pharmaceutical ecosystem is globally renowned for its robust manufacturing capabilities, particularly for advanced beta-lactamase inhibitor combinations like Sultamicillin 375 mg. Because Sultamicillin requires strict environmental controls during formulation to avoid cross-contamination and maintain the stability of the component elements (Ampicillin and Sulbactam), specialized infrastructure is critical.
Top Indian manufacturers operate state-of-the-art facilities located in major pharma hubs like Gujarat (Vapi, Surat), Himachal Pradesh (Baddi), and Punjab. Industry leaders such as Taj Pharma, Intelico Pharmaceuticals, Systole Remedies, and Wellona Pharma have set the gold standard in large-scale production, supplying both the domestic market and exporting to over 40 countries across Africa, LATAM, and Southeast Asia.
The global demand for Sultamicillin 375 mg tablets is met largely by Indian manufacturers due to several structural and technical advantages:
World-Class Regulatory Approvals: Leading manufacturing units are certified by major regulatory bodies, including WHO-GMP, ISO 9001:2015, and the CDSCO (DCGI). This ensures that every batch meets stringent international efficacy and safety benchmarks.
Advanced Formulation Technology: Sultamicillin Tosylate Dihydrate is highly sensitive to moisture. Indian manufacturing facilities utilize automated, climate-controlled, and validated processes alongside premium Alu-Alu and blister packaging to secure maximum shelf-life (typically 24 to 36 months).
Cost-Efficient Production Scale: By leveraging vast economies of scale and highly skilled pharma professionals, manufacturers in India offer incredibly competitive B2B pricing without compromising on raw material purity or safety standards.
Comprehensive Regulatory Support: For export markets, Indian contract manufacturers provide extensive documentation support, including CTD/eCTD dossiers, stability testing data, and country-specific multilingual labeling.
